I had 5 eggs arrive to me like that, I traced the air cells, tilting them to their furthest and put the them furthest away from the heating source and fan that I could. I also re marked my X and O for turning so the jacked up bit would never have air in it. I hatched them in cartons tilting them toward the marked area, I have 4 of 5 to hatch. 5th one was fully developed and the yoke was absorbed, looks like it was too dry and never broke the air sac...to bad, was the nicest shade of blue.
